Product Features
1. The control system is integrated with the SIEMENS 828D CNC system, paired with servo motor-driven feeding mechanisms. This configuration guarantees superior operational efficiency while ensuring consistent precision throughout the processing of workpieces.
2. A servo-driven central alignment device is mounted on the feeding support roller, enabling it to efficiently process plates with varying cross-sectional profiles and accommodate height variations ranging from 0 to 200mm.
![]()
3. The system is engineered to support up to 25 molds of varying diameters, featuring a rapid and intuitive mold installation process.
4. The loading, punching, and unloading of plates are entirely automated, drastically reducing labor demands and optimizing operational efficiency.
5. Waste materials are automatically ejected and collected, ensuring a smooth and efficient production flow.
![]()
6. The automated programming software allows for the direct import of graphics from AUTOCAD or .DXF files created by other CAD software. Featuring an intuitive human-machine interface, it enables the automatic generation of machine tool processing programs, thereby reducing time expenditure and minimizing the risk of errors.
